Nicolaus Copernicus was a Polish astronomer who developed the heliocentric theory of the universe in the 16th century. His theory stated that the sun was at the center of the universe, and that the earth and other planets revolved around it. This was a revolutionary idea at the time, as it challenged the long-held belief that the earth was the center of the universe.

The first step in teaching students about Copernicus’ theory is to provide them with some historical context. They should be introduced to the ideas that prevailed before Copernicus, and the prevailing belief that the earth was the center of the universe. This can be done using historical texts and illustrations from the time period.
Once students have an understanding of the scientific worldview before Copernicus, they can be introduced to his heliocentric theory. Teachers can use a variety of activities and resources to help students understand this concept.
This might include videos, interactive simulations, and hands-on activities like creating models of the solar system.
One particularly effective way to teach about Copernicus’ theory is to have students compare it to the geocentric theory that came before it. This can be done by having students create diagrams showing the relative positions of the planets in each theory, and discussing the implications of each theory for things like astrology and navigation.
Another important aspect of teaching students about Copernicus’ theory is to discuss the resistance he faced in his own time. Many religious and political authorities opposed his ideas, and he faced significant opposition from within the scientific community as well. This can be used as a way to discuss the politics of scientific discovery and the role of scientists in challenging prevailing beliefs.
